Planning facts are copied from official government GIS where available. Where an official property PDF exists (VicPlan, PlanBuild), Districts stores and serves that original document. Neither is a planning certificate, survey, or advice.

Welcome to 32 Bibra Drive, Bibra Lake, a solidly built home completed in 1985 that offers generous living spaces, timeless character and exciting potential to make it your own. Freshly painted throughout, this welcoming residence is ready to enjoy from day one while still offering scope to add your personal touches over time. Perfectly positioned opposite the tranquil Bibra Lake bushland, this is a lifestyle opportunity that combines comfort, convenience and nature.
Designed with family living in mind, the home features a spacious front lounge with carpeted flooring, a separate dining room and a central living area complete with retro slate tiles and a cosy combustion fireplace, creating the perfect place to gather during the cooler months. The renovated kitchen is both stylish and practical, boasting stone benchtops, a ceramic cooktop, an electric wall oven and a lovely outlook across the backyard, making meal preparation a pleasure.
The accommodation is equally appealing, with a spacious main bedroom featuring built-in robes and peaceful views over a private courtyard garden. Two additional bedrooms provide flexibility for growing families, guests or those working from home, with Bedroom 2 ideally suited as a study, home office or child's room, while Bedroom 3 includes a built-in robe. The generous bathroom offers both a separate bath and shower, while the spacious laundry and separate toilet add everyday functionality. Although the bedroom wing carpets could benefit from updating, they present an excellent opportunity to personalise the home to your own style.
Outside, the expansive backyard is sure to impress. Beautifully established gardens, lush lawns and a stunning jacaranda tree create a picturesque setting where children can play, pets can roam and family gatherings can be enjoyed. A garden shed provides extra storage, while the single carport offers drive-through rear access for added convenience.
